Transaction 61f9914fb04a4c7539ce232f6326bbe35af91cfdc864673d0e639f45b1945d1e
1 Input
1 Output
-
61f9914fb04a4c7539ce232f6326bbe35af91cfdc864673d0e639f45b1945d1e:0
- value
- 64079
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 607c42fb35fdcbc25e31e4b63834ffa2a0d61530 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19oAjGSaMrKbdUM7sXcQaiFNKUydBjgbiu